Reminiscing and Sensory Stimulation with Nursing Homes throughout Northeastern Ohio

Dementia Friendly LIFE partners with nursing homes to give seniors sensory-stimulating activities . During these visits, we take life-like baby dolls to nursing homes, play popular music from an earlier time, and provide baby lotion to the seniors so they are reminded of happy times.

Giving to Friendship Animal Protective League

Dementia Friendly LIFE held an event where seniors and their caregivers created blankets and toys to give to the Friendship APL, helping those living with dementia to give back and participate in the community. Crafting and creating helps keep fine motor skills working, and the communal aspect of working together to give back gives seniors a sense of purpose.

Partnering with JVS and College Students

Dementia Friendly LIFE partners with the Joint Vocational School, High Schools, and Colleges to help students get experience working with patients living with dementia.
